Last thursday night I took a gojek  (motorcycle taxi) to tugu train station, the main station in Jojgja).
Around 9 pm my train left to Malang, East-Java. I was supposed to join in some beach party  event organized by darmasiswa people from Surabaya. Rent scooters and camping equipment from Malang and go to Pulau Sempu island South from Malang.
The  train arrived around 3:30 am, after bumming at the station I looked around in the waking Malang. Traces of  colonial grandiose create a peculiar atmosphere I like; wide avenues, gigantic trees and trashbins whereever.





























Then I met the crew, rented scooters, it turned out that Pulau Sempu is closed so made new plans. After some hours of scooter ride on wonderful Javanese landscapes we arrived to Air Terjun Coban Sewu.



















Then we finally arrived to Panatai Bolu Bolu beach after some hours of scooter rambling and adventures.





Almost  empty beach, arrived there after sunset and roller coaster scooter ride in the hillside.



Had dinner of fried zuvis (fish) breakfast of coconuts, tropical klischés:)

Next day the navigation sent me to some butt killer destructive ride thruogh the jungle to get to Pantai Sendiki, a much more accessible beach, where we camped overnight
